سؤال

في وثائق YII تقول:

foreach($_POST['LoginForm'] as $name=>$value)
{
    if($name is a safe attribute)
        $model->$name=$value;
}

ما الذي يأتي منه تسجيل الدخول؟ ما هي السمة التي تقترن بها؟

هل كانت مفيدة؟

المحلول

في PHP ، يحتوي $ _post على حقول الإدخال "المنشورة" من نموذج HTML.

في نموذج HTML ، تحتوي العناصر على أسماء

Address: <input type='text' name='LoginForm[addr]'>
City: <input type='text' name='LoginForm[city]'>
ST: <input type='text' name='LoginForm[st]'>

لذلك عندما يوفر PHP هذا الإدخال إلى البرنامج النصي ، فإنه يجعل الإدخال في صفيف بواسطة الأسماء ، والتي يمكنك التكرار مع foreach.

نصائح أخرى

صفيف $ _post؟ إذا كان الأمر كذلك ، فهذا متغير محجوز/محدد مسبقًا ، وعادة ما يكون محتويات نتيجة النماذج المقدمة. هل هذا ما تسأل عنه؟

http://www.php.net/manual/en/reserved.variables.php

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top